Fire-Resistant Fiber Cement Siding Material

James Hardie® HardiePlank® siding is installed using nails like standard masonry products, but it actually consists primarily of cement that shares performance attributes with stucco, brick and natural stone. This means fiber cement siding is just as (if not more) fire-resistant as these materials. HardiePlank®, in fact, will not ignite when exposed to direct flame, and will not contribute fuel to the fire. This is a huge contrast to wood shake siding, which burns quickly.

Some Things to Consider

You should note, however, that while James Hardie® HardiePlank® siding is non-combustible and doesn’t add literal fuel to the fire, heat does transfer through the material. It’s not 1-hour fire rated, but it does qualify for use in certain 1-hour fire-rated Warnock Hersey and UL Assemblies. James Hardie® HardiePlank® siding can give homeowners enough time to get to safety before the fire spreads.
